Broken Panes

A rogue baseball or heavy winds can cause damage to a window pane, leaving your home vulnerable to the elements. However, replacing a single window isn't as difficult as you might think and is a cheaper fix than purchasing an entirely new window or hiring a professional. You can replace a broken pane of glass quickly and easily by using a few simple tools.

Wear safety goggles before you begin. Clean the area around the glass window of glass crystals or glass chards. Remove any old varnish or paint from the frame of wood. If you have a sash made of metal with saddle bars, take them off. them as well. Next, put on a utility knife and carefully remove the trim from the window frames. Be careful not to damage any lead that is on the glass and do not try to break it too badly.

If you are using a new pane, it's recommended to cut it in a hardware shop. This will ensure that the glass is the proper size. You must subtract 1/8 of an inch from the actual size of the opening to allow for the glass. This is because wood expands and contracts.

The majority of single pane windows are secured by glazing putty and small metal clips referred to as glazier's point. Apply a generous amount of glaziers ' putty on the broken glass on the wood frame. Press glazier's points into putty approximately every six inches. This will hold the window in position and allow you to reseal the frame later.

Before applying any putty, dampen your finger with linseed oil and rub it across the surface of the wood. This will lubricate the putty and make it easier to work with. Glazing putty is a finite product that will dry out over time. Add a few drops of Linseed to the mix to prolong its shelf life. Once the putty is moist, you can begin repairing your window.

Broken Seals

Over time the rubber used to seal double-paned windows will disintegrate. Suggested Internet site makes the window more susceptible to moisture, which compromises its function and allowing in cold air or warm humidity. The first sign of a broken seal is fog or condensation between the two panes of glass. Another sign is a difference in temperature between your home and the outside. A broken seal can cause your windows to appear hazy or discolored as the vacuum-sealed argon gas escapes.

Sashes That Won't Open

A sash that won't open can be more than a nuisance. It can also be dangerous. The sash can fall down unexpectedly, damaging everything on the sill, including children and pets. Double-hung and single-hung windows include balancing mechanisms that keep the sash away from the jambs. It could be that the sash has not been properly connected to the mechanisms or that it needs to be reset or locked.

Start by testing if the window moves. If it doesn't you can try putting an instrument that is placed on the rail where the upper and lower sashes join to break them apart. If the window does move, remove the sash and place it on a work surface to reach the sides. If the sash's spline is loose in only one or two places it is possible to employ a utility knife cut it in the corners. If the spline is damaged or completely broken and you need to replace it.

If the sash remains stuck, it could be necessary to cut off the front trim piece. Hardware stores have tools to do this. A putty knife will also be a good option. Utilizing your cutting tool score the seal of paint that covers the sash channels. Then, remove the screws that hold the stops in the frame. After this is done, you'll be able to remove the sash from the frame and move it correctly.

If the sash is stuck, it's likely that the balance shoe has slid to the bottom of the frame. Resetting it is simple to mark the location of the hinge channel on the frame and unscrew it. Fill the screwholes with woodfiller or epoxy and smooth them before reinstalling channel. Lock the balance pin when the hinge channel has been installed by moving it into the "U-position". Reposition the sash in a way that it aligns with the balance and try it again.

Wood Rot

Wood rot isn't just an eyesore; it can also cause serious structural damage to a property. Dry and wet rot are just two of the many forms. In both instances, the damage is caused by a combination of moisture and fungus. Both wet and dried decay can be treated. However, it is best to stop the cause. Property owners can look for decay in areas that are likely to become damp, such as outside window frames, timber joists and basement subfloors. They should also check wood in any gaps or cracks.

If a hole is discovered the area must be cleaned and filled with a water-resistant timber filler. Once the wood has dries it is then stained to match the surrounding material. If you decide to use stain for wood it is important to test the product on a small area of the filler prior to applying. This will ensure that the stain does not alter color, corrode, or alter the final look of your woodwork.

Wet rot is easily identified by its musty odor that's similar to that of rotting soil. It's also less brittle than wood that isn't infected and is therefore easier to feel with your hand. Dry rot however is more difficult to detect. This type of fungus attacks wood cells, making them to break down and disintegrate.

Dry rot is more difficult to fix because it can infiltrate further. However, it is still able to be prevented by identifying the source of moisture and repairing it, for instance, the presence of a leak or getting into damp. It is also important to clean your gutters to prevent the buildup of water that can cause leaks within your home or in a cellar that is flooded.


Homeowners can reduce the chance of decay by keeping windows open and installing a dehumidifier into basements and crawl spaces. They should also be sure to clean the sealant or caulking around windows and doors to stop water from entering into gaps. In addition, they should replace cracked or damaged timbers.
